Publisher source files• Usually in text-backed PDF format

• Usually untagged

• Often incorrectly paginated

• Often have incorrect reading order

• Often have supplementary text (margin text, footnotes, captions, etc.)

• Almost never meet OCR accessibility guidelines

• Never student-ready

Alt Format at WorkDolphin EasyConverter

• Converts one source file to multiple formats– Text (including MS Word document)– Compressed audio (mp3)– DAISY 2.02 or DAISY 3 digital talking book (dtb)– Large print (.docx, .doc file)– Braille

• Easy to use yet sophisticated– Wizard approach– Step-by-step guidance for alt format “newbies”– Customization options for alt format experts

Preparing for Conversion• Use EasyConverter wisely

– EC is your essential altformat production partner– if you use it as magic, the results might be disappointing

• Prepare pre-production files according to alt format best practices– Edit prior to input to EC or mid-production– paginate correctly– apply styles/headings– punctuate appropriately– perform other mark-up as needed (e.g. math, foreign language)
